HCRM博客

小程序开发入门,一步步教你如何打造自己的微信小程序

小程序是一种无需下载安装即可使用的应用,它实现了“触手可及”的便捷性,用户扫一扫或搜一下即可打开应用,它也具备了传统APP的功能,如消息通知、离线缓存等,开发一个小程序需要经过一系列步骤,从前期准备到最终发布和运营,每一步都至关重要,以下是具体的操作步骤:

确定需求与目标

1、明确需求:在开始开发小程序之前,首先要明确自己的需求和开发目标,确定你的小程序想要提供什么样的功能和服务,以及目标用户群体是谁,这一步是整个开发过程的基础,决定了后续工作的方向。

小程序开发入门,一步步教你如何打造自己的微信小程序-图1
(图片来源网络,侵权删除)

2、制定目标:根据需求制定具体的开发目标,包括小程序的核心功能、用户体验目标、技术选型等,这些目标将指导整个开发过程,确保项目按计划进行。

掌握小程序框架

1、学习小程序框架:学习并掌握小程序框架,如微信小程序的框架和API,以及其他平台的小程序开发框架,了解框架的基本结构和使用方法,为后续开发打下基础。

2、熟悉开发文档:阅读相应平台的开发文档,了解开发规范、接口调用、组件使用等内容,这些文档是开发过程中的重要参考资料,有助于解决开发中遇到的问题。

搭建开发环境

1、下载开发工具:下载并安装适用于相应平台的小程序开发工具,如微信开发者工具等,这些工具提供了代码编辑、调试、预览等功能,方便开发者进行开发和测试。

2、注册开发者账号:注册相应平台的开发者账号,如微信公众平台开发者账号,通过注册开发者账号,你可以获取AppID等必要信息,用于创建小程序项目。

3、创建小程序项目:在开发工具中创建新的小程序项目,并设置相应的项目名称、AppID等信息,这一步将生成小程序的基本框架,为后续开发做好准备。

小程序开发入门,一步步教你如何打造自己的微信小程序-图2
(图片来源网络,侵权删除)

开发页面与功能

1、设计页面结构:根据需求设计小程序的页面结构,确定页面布局和组件,可以使用原型设计工具绘制页面草图,以便更直观地展示设计方案。

2、编写前端代码:使用HTML、CSS和JavaScript等技术编写小程序的前端代码,实现页面的样式和交互功能,在编写代码时,要注意代码的规范性和可读性,以便于后期维护和更新。

3、调试与优化:在开发过程中进行页面调试和优化,确保小程序的运行效果和用户体验,可以使用开发者工具提供的调试功能,检查代码错误、性能问题等,并进行相应的优化处理。

实现后端功能

1、选择后端技术:根据小程序的需求选择合适的后端技术,如Node.js、Python、Java等,不同的后端技术有不同的特点和优势,选择适合自己项目的后端技术可以提高开发效率和质量。

2、开发后端服务:使用选定的后端技术开发小程序所需的后端服务,如用户认证、数据存储等功能,在开发过程中,要注意接口的安全性和稳定性,确保数据的正确传输和处理。

3、接口对接:将前端和后端进行接口对接,确保数据的正常传输和交互,在对接过程中,要遵循相应的接口规范和协议,保证数据的一致性和完整性。

小程序开发入门,一步步教你如何打造自己的微信小程序-图3
(图片来源网络,侵权删除)

测试与调试

1、功能测试:在开发完成后进行小程序的功能测试,确保各项功能正常运行,可以编写测试用例对关键功能进行验证,发现并修复潜在的问题。

2、性能测试:对小程序的性能进行测试,包括响应速度、内存占用等方面,通过性能测试可以发现并优化性能瓶颈,提高小程序的运行效率。

3、兼容性测试:在不同设备和浏览器上进行兼容性测试,确保小程序能够正常运行,对于发现的兼容性问题要及时修复和优化。

提交审核发布

1、提交审核:在开发工具中提交小程序审核,确保小程序符合相应平台的审核标准,在提交审核前要仔细检查小程序的各项功能和内容是否符合要求。

2、发布小程序:审核通过后将小程序发布到相应的小程序商店或平台供用户下载和使用,在发布前要做好宣传和推广工作吸引更多的用户关注和使用。

运营与维护

1、运营策略:制定小程序的运营策略包括推广、用户反馈处理、活动策划等,通过有效的运营策略可以提高小程序的知名度和用户粘性促进其持续发展。

2、持续维护:定期更新小程序修复bug优化用户体验持续提升小程序的质量和功能,同时要及时关注市场动态和技术发展趋势不断调整和完善小程序以满足用户需求和市场变化。

相关问答FAQs

1、:如何提高小程序的用户留存率?

:提高用户留存率可以通过多种方法,如提供个性化推荐、定期推送有价值的内容、举办互动活动等,优化用户体验和界面设计也是关键因素之一。

2、:在开发过程中遇到技术难题怎么办?

:遇到技术难题时,首先可以尝试查阅官方文档或搜索相关论坛和社区寻求解决方案,如果问题仍未解决,可以考虑请教其他开发者或参加技术交流会议获取帮助。

分享:
扫描分享到社交APP
上一篇
下一篇